Gradio界面使用指南:可视化操作HY-Motion模型教程

张开发
2026/4/9 19:11:27 15 分钟阅读

分享文章

Gradio界面使用指南:可视化操作HY-Motion模型教程
Gradio界面使用指南可视化操作HY-Motion模型教程想用一句话就让3D角色动起来吗HY-Motion 1.0让这个想法变成了现实。这是一个能听懂你描述并生成高质量3D人体动作的AI模型。想象一下你只需要输入“一个人在做俯卧撑”它就能为你生成一套流畅、自然的3D骨骼动画直接用在你的游戏、动画或者虚拟人项目中。今天我们不聊复杂的代码和命令行而是带你走进一个更直观、更友好的世界——Gradio可视化界面。通过这个网页界面你可以像使用一个在线工具一样轻松玩转HY-Motion无需任何编程基础。接下来我会手把手教你如何启动它、使用它并生成你的第一个3D动作。1. 准备工作认识HY-Motion与Gradio在开始动手之前我们先花几分钟了解一下今天的主角们。1.1 HY-Motion 1.0是什么HY-Motion 1.0是一个“文生3D动作”的大模型。简单来说它是一个非常聪明的AI专门学习过成千上万种人类动作。它的核心能力是你告诉它你想看什么动作它就能生成对应的3D骨骼动画。它有几个非常厉害的特点理解能力强采用了十亿级别的参数规模能更准确地理解你的文字描述。动作质量高生成的动画流畅、自然细节丰富。直接可用生成的动画是基于标准骨骼的可以直接导入到Blender、Maya、Unity、Unreal Engine等主流3D软件中使用。1.2 为什么选择Gradio界面对于大多数开发者、动画师甚至爱好者来说直接通过代码调用模型有一定门槛。Gradio解决了这个问题它为你提供了一个即开即用的网页操作界面。使用Gradio界面的好处显而易见零代码操作所有功能都变成了网页上的按钮和输入框。实时预览输入描述后可以直接在网页上看到生成的动作视频。降低门槛让不熟悉Python和深度学习的用户也能快速体验AI生成动画的魅力。接下来我们就进入正题看看如何把这个强大的工具运行起来。2. 启动Gradio可视化界面启动过程非常简单只需要一条命令。请确保你已经按照HY-Motion项目的官方指南完成了基础环境的配置如Docker镜像的拉取和运行。2.1 一键启动命令在已经配置好的环境终端中输入以下命令bash /root/build/HY-Motion-1.0/start.sh执行这条命令后系统会启动Gradio服务。你会看到终端开始输出一些日志信息这个过程通常很快。2.2 访问操作界面当你在终端看到类似Running on local URL: http://0.0.0.0:7860的提示时说明服务已经成功启动。这时你有两种方式可以打开操作界面直接点击链接如果终端支持你可以直接点击日志中输出的http://localhost:7860这个链接。手动输入地址在你的电脑浏览器中直接输入地址http://localhost:7860成功打开后你将看到一个清晰、直观的网页操作界面如下图所示界面主要分为三个区域左侧参数设置和提示词输入区。中部动作生成结果显示区。右侧模型信息与示例区。看到这个界面就意味着你已经成功了一大半接下来我们学习如何与它交互。3. 界面功能详解与操作步骤现在让我们像探索一个新软件一样详细了解界面上的每一个功能模块并完成一次完整的动作生成。3.1 核心参数设置左侧面板在生成动作前我们可以在左侧面板调整几个关键参数它们会影响生成结果的质量和速度。Model Path模型路径这里通常已经预填好了HY-Motion模型的路径一般不需要修改。Num Seeds生成种子数这个参数控制AI“尝试”的次数。设为1表示只生成1个结果设为3AI会基于你的描述生成3个略有不同的动作然后你可以从中挑选最好的一个。数值越大生成时间越长显存占用也越高。初次尝试建议设为1。Motion Length动作长度这里设置你想生成的动作时长单位是秒。例如输入5就是生成一段5秒的动画。注意时间越长对显存的要求越高生成也可能更慢。建议从3-5秒开始尝试。3.2 输入你的动作描述最关键的一步这是整个流程的灵魂。在“Enter your prompt here”下方的文本框中用英文描述你想要的动作。如何写出好的提示词Prompt使用英文模型目前对英文的理解更好请务必使用英文描述。描述要具体越具体的描述生成的动作越符合预期。基础描述A person is walking.一个人在走路更好描述A person walks slowly with hands in pockets, looking around.一个人手插口袋慢慢走路四处张望聚焦动作本身描述应集中在身体部位的动作上比如走、跑、跳、挥手、弯腰等。控制长度尽量将描述控制在60个单词以内过长的描述可能会影响模型理解。输入示例 你可以直接复制下面的例子到文本框中进行尝试A person stands up from the chair, then stretches their arms. 一个人从椅子上站起来然后伸展手臂。3.3 生成并查看结果输入描述并设置好参数后点击界面下方的“Generate Motion”按钮。这时你会看到按钮变成加载状态界面中央会显示“Generating...”的提示。生成时间取决于你的描述复杂度、动作长度和硬件性能通常需要几十秒到几分钟。生成完成后结果会显示在界面中央你会看到两部分内容3D动作视频一个循环播放的动画视频展示生成的角色骨骼如何运动。提示词回显下方会再次显示你输入的提示词方便核对。3.4 结果处理与下载如果你对生成的动作满意可以进行以下操作重新生成直接修改提示词或参数再次点击“Generate Motion”。下载结果Gradio界面通常提供视频下载链接或按钮你可以将生成的动作视频保存到本地。查看不同种子如果你设置了Num Seeds大于1界面可能会以标签页或列表形式展示所有结果你可以对比并选择最喜欢的一个。4. 从想法到动画实用技巧与案例了解了基本操作后我们通过几个具体的案例来看看如何将你的创意转化为生动的3D动画。4.1 案例一生成一套健身动作你的想法我想生成一个“深蹲后推举杠铃”的连贯健身动作。提示词这样写A person performs a squat, then pushes a barbell overhead using the power from standing up.一个人做一个深蹲然后利用站起的力量将杠铃推举过头顶。技巧点拨使用了perform a squat和pushes a barbell overhead两个明确的动作短语。用then连接表达了动作的先后顺序。using the power from standing up增加了动作的连贯性和发力逻辑有助于生成更自然的过渡。4.2 案例二生成一个攀爬动作你的想法需要一个角色在斜坡上向上攀爬的动画。提示词这样写A person climbs upward, moving up the slope.一个人向上攀爬在斜坡上移动。技巧点拨climbs upward指明了核心动作和方向。moving up the slope补充了动作发生的环境斜坡这能帮助模型更好地理解肢体应该如何协调用力。4.3 案例三生成日常疲惫状态你的想法表现一个人走路不稳然后慢慢坐下的疲惫状态。提示词这样写A person walks unsteadily, then slowly sits down.一个人走路不稳然后慢慢坐下。技巧点拨walks unsteadily比单纯的walks包含了更多的状态信息不稳定、摇晃能生成更具表现力的步态。slowly sits down中的slowly是很好的副词可以影响动作的速度和节奏感。4.4 需要避免的描述为了让模型更好地工作请避免输入以下类型的内容非人形生物如A dog is running.模型只学习了人类动作。外貌和情绪如A happy person with blue hair.模型不理解外观和情绪只理解动作。场景和物体如A person picks up a cup on the table.模型无法生成与物体交互的精确动作。多人互动如Two people are dancing.目前只支持单人生成。循环动作如A person is walking in place.生成的动作是线性有始有终的。5. 常见问题与优化建议在使用过程中你可能会遇到一些小问题这里提供一些解决思路。5.1 生成速度很慢怎么办生成速度主要取决于你的硬件特别是GPU和生成参数。降低Motion Length生成3秒动画远比生成10秒动画快。减少Num Seeds设为1是最快的。简化提示词非常复杂、冗长的描述可能需要更长的计算时间。5.2 生成的动作很奇怪不符合描述这通常和提示词有关。检查语法和拼写简单的英文错误可能导致模型误解。让描述更直接用最核心的动词walk, run, jump, wave来描述。先尝试A person is walking.这样的简单句确保基础功能正常再增加修饰词。参考示例多使用界面右侧或官方提供的示例提示词感受一下“有效描述”的写法。5.3 遇到错误或界面无响应检查服务是否运行回到终端确认Gradio服务没有报错停止。刷新浏览器页面有时网络延迟可能导致界面卡住尝试刷新。查看终端日志终端里通常会打印出详细的错误信息这是排查问题的关键。6. 总结通过这篇指南你已经掌握了使用Gradio界面操作HY-Motion 1.0模型的核心方法。让我们简单回顾一下启动很简单一行bash命令就能打开网页操作台。操作很直观在左侧输入英文动作描述调整好时长和生成次数点击按钮即可。描述是关键用简洁、具体的英文句子描述身体动作避免描述外观、场景和多人互动。结果立即可见等待片刻就能在网页上预览并下载生成的3D骨骼动画。这个可视化工具极大地降低了AI 3D动画生成的门槛。无论你是想为游戏快速制作原型动作还是为动画项目寻找灵感或者只是对这项技术感到好奇现在都可以轻松上手尝试。从“一个人在做俯卧撑”到“一个疲惫的人摇晃着坐下”你的文字就是最好的导演指令。快去启动Gradio输入你的第一个创意描述亲眼见证文字变成生动动画的神奇过程吧获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。

更多文章